su27rules Posted September 13, 2010 Share Posted September 13, 2010 (edited) Hello ARC-ers, Here are some preview pictures from forthcoming 1:72 resin kits of a J-21 Jastreb (Hawk) and G-2 Galeb (Seagull) aircrafts from "L&M Resin scale kits" ( www.LMRESIN.com) and their producer "tlikso" on this forum. "L&M Resin scale kits" from Croatia is famous in production of aircraft types from ex - Yugoslavia and aircraft flow with Croatian Air Force, like J-22 Orao (Eagle) and Pilatus PC-9, etc.After this boxes it will be more editions with more decal options,like airshow team Flying Stars,prototype and other users(Libya,etc). flanker Posted September 15, 2010 Share Posted September 15, 2010 (edited) Letece Zvezde(Flying Stars) colud be only with LM J21 kit J-21 was replaced in with G-4 latter in YAF acro team. Letece Zvezde never fly on G-2 (only serbian,private owned "Stars" acro team uses them) Stars Edited September 15, 2010 by flanker Quote Link to post Share on other sites

flanker Posted December 4, 2010 Share Posted December 4, 2010 this decal sheet is for: 1. Galeb prototype, No.0537, VOC 2. Galeb-2 prototype, No.23001, VOC 3. G-2A, No.23108, 107.AP, preserved in the MJV 4. G-2A, No.23194, YU-YAG, Aero Club “Galeb†5. G-2AE, No.10105, Libyan Arab Republic Air Force 6. Jastreb prototype, No.24001, VOC 7. J-21, No.24124, 235.LBAE, 198.ABR 8. J-21, No.24136, 241.LBAE, 198.ABR 9. J-21, No.24261, 892.MABR VRS Quote Link to post Share on other sites
